The first step in making a clay chimney is to make a pot. This can be done by using two methods. One method is to coil long snakes of clay into a shape and then smooth them. Another option is to use a wheel and throw the pot into shape. The potter needs to be a skilled craftsman to get the pot in the desired shape.

When the pot has been constructed and fired, it is required to fire it. This is known as bisque firing. The clay is heated up to around 1000 degrees Fahrenheit. This process alters the clay's structure and causes it to shrink. Once the clay is bisque fired, it is ready for a second firing. This second firing is used to fix the glaze and to color.

There are a variety of styles of chimineas. These include traditional clay models and cast iron ones. Each has its own advantages and disadvantages. Clay chimineas, for example are more expensive and brittle than cast-iron ones. They are also prone to crack or chip if they aren't seasoned correctly. Cast iron chimineas on the other hand, are very robust and can withstand high temperatures. They also tend to be larger which makes them ideal to cook on. However they can be heavy and require a hearth for the patio.

A chiminea can also be a good choice for people who wish to reduce the amount of smoke that is in their yard. The chiminea's closed design as well as chimney will direct smoke away from the people. This keeps the air in your outdoor space clean and comfortable. Smoke can be lessened by using only wood that has been seasoned.

Chimineas must always be placed on a fire-safe base, like concrete, sand, or a hearth pad. Chimineas should be kept at least 3 feet away from any combustible material and should not be left alone while in operation. It's also an excellent idea to install a spark screen and keep children and pets away from the open flame.
